Whitney Leavitt’s Take on a Potential Spinoff Amid Taylor Frankie Paul Controversy
Whitney Leavitt, 32, took to TikTok on March 30 to share a playful video with her husband Conner, also 32, captioning it, “How it feels knowing y’all want a Leavitt spinoff.” The clip quickly caught the attention of *The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ives* fans, many of whom have expressed interest in seeing more of the couple’s life on screen. This enthusiasm has grown especially strong since the show’s production was paused due to the ongoing investigation into Taylor Frankie Paul’s alleged domestic violence incident.
Taylor, 31, has been at the center of a serious legal situation involving her ex-boyfriend Dakota Mortensen. Earlier this year, Taylor pleaded guilty to aggravated assault following a 2023 arrest related to a physical altercation with Dakota. The plea deal resulted in the dismissal of additional charges, including domestic violence in the presence of a child, child abuse with injury, and criminal mischief. Taylor shares three children—Indy, 8, and Ocean, 5, with her ex-husband Tate Paul, and Ever, 2, with Dakota.
Leaked footage from the incident showed Taylor throwing chairs during the altercation, with one chair reportedly striking her daughter. The fallout from this scandal led ABC to cancel Taylor’s upcoming season of *The Bachelorette*, a significant blow to her television career.
A representative for Taylor released a statement expressing gratitude for ABC’s support and emphasizing her focus on family safety. “Taylor has remained silent out of fear of further abuse, retaliation, and public shaming,” the rep said. “She is currently exploring all of her options, seeking support and preparing to own and share her story.” Meanwhile, Dakota was granted a temporary protective order against Taylor and awarded sole custody of their son Ever.
Impact on The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ives and Cast Relationships
The Taylor Frankie Paul scandal has had ripple effects throughout the cast and production of *The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ives*. With filming on hold, fans have turned their attention to other cast members, including Whitney and Conner Leavitt, who have become fan favorites for their candid and relatable portrayal of married life.
In addition to the Taylor controversy, another cast shakeup occurred when Jordan Ngatikaura filed for divorce from Jessi Draper. Jordan, 31, shared a heartfelt message about the split, emphasizing his commitment to their children and a respectful transition. Jessi, 33, later spoke publicly about the divorce on the “Call Her Daddy” podcast, revealing that Jordan had filed for divorce unexpectedly, despite their agreement to handle the announcement together. The drama intensified when Jessi was seen kissing Miranda McWhorter’s ex-husband Chase McWhorter at a party, though sources say the relationship is not serious.
These personal challenges among cast members have added layers of complexity to the show’s narrative, making it difficult for production to continue smoothly. Fans are left wondering how these real-life events will influence the future of the series and its potential spinoffs.
